    In every job at Rod's House, our mission and vision are embedded deeply into the responsibilities. A job at Rod's House is about more than completing tasks; rather, it is about prioritizing building positive and lasting relationships with the young people, other staff, volunteers, and our community.


    Our Mission:
    Rod's House builds authentic connections with young people, encourages them in feeling respected and secure in who they are, empowers them to reach their full potential, and positively connects them to the community.


    Our Vision:
    Rod's House envisions an END to youth homelessness in the Yakima Valley. To break the cycle of homelessness we engage volunteers, donors, and the community to ensure young people's basic human needs are met and that they have a safe, stable home; permanent, positive connections; meaningful education and employment opportunities; behavioral and physical health care; and supports that reinforce their individual abilities.

    Position Information

    Title: Young Adult Emergency Home Support Specialist

    FLSA Status: Hourly, Full-Time, Non-Exempt

    Location: Young Adult Emergency Home

    Reports to: Young Adult Emergency Home Program Coordinator

    Overview (what unique role does this position play within Rod's House?)

    Support Specialists at Rod's House focus on providing a safe and stable environment for young people to learn new skills in order to thrive on their own in the community. Support Specialists help support a wide-spectrum of needs for young people (ages experiencing homelessness throughout Yakima County. Support Specialists play a pivotal role as guides for young people so they may progress from temporary sheltering to permanent, safe, and stable housing.

    Duties and Responsibilities

    Relationship Building and Problem Solving

    • Engage with young adults to make them feel welcome, safe, and supported;
    • Collaborate with Case Manager, Behavioral Health Specialist, and Program Coordinator on how best to support youth;
    • Connect youth to community and on-site resources to ensure basic needs are met;
    • Appropriately respond to and coach youth through verbal, physical, and emotional altercations;
    • Prevent and de-escalate situations as they arise;
    • Maintain a positive, non-judgmental, trauma-informed approach;
    • Actively seek opportunities to be inclusive and equitable;
    • Accompany youth to designated recreational activities and meal times;

    Safety and Cleanliness

    • Assist with housekeeping duties and ensure cleanliness and tidiness at all times;
    • Ensure a safe environment for fellow employees, volunteers, and residents;
    • Conduct safety drills with proper documentation, as assigned by Program Coordinator;
    • Ensure completion of daily tasks by end of each shift;
    • Review health guidelines and organize food on a daily basis;
    • Oversee knife check-out system whenever one is used for meal prep.

    Data Management

    • Participate in monthly program outcome reporting with all program staff;
    • Complete data entry tasks, as assigned;
    • Prioritize keeping information on young people confidential and secure;
    • Maintain proper record keeping.

    General

    • Ensure standard operating procedures are clearing defined, updated, and followed;
    • Provide regular feedback on program policies and procedures, as needed;
    • Maintain program training requirements as required by service site;
    • Provide general assistance and support as directed.

    Complete all duties as assigned and other duties as required.

    Work Conditions and Physical Requirements

    Shifts could include evening, early mornings, or weekends, including holidays. This position requires daily interactions with youth experiencing homelessness and with community members, social service providers, and other organizations.. Physical requirements for the position include frequent walking, hearing, seeing, speaking, stooping, kneeling, crouching, reaching, grasping, climbing, and repetitive motions. This position requires exerting up to 50 pounds of force to lift, carry, pull, or move objects. Ability to safely drive a 14-passenger van is strongly preferred.
